Questions and No answers
As Kagome neared the bottom of the well, all these memories
flashed back through her head. She felt something wet hit her,
she looked up to see the silver-haired half demon, Inuyasha
crying on her behalf. "No way, Inuyahsa would never cry for
me." Kagome convinced herself. When Kagome finally got
home, she thought maybe she had been too hard on
Inuyahsa. "Oh well, I can't go back now, I guess I just have to
live without him. I mean, what am I supposed to do, just march
right up to him and tell him I'm sorry, He's the one who should
be apologizing!" Kagome came back to her senses. Under her
breath she softly whispered, "But I still love him." Sniffling under
tears, she decided she should just forget about him, after the
way she treated him, why would he even want to come back?
"Oh Inuyahsa" Kagome softly sighed. She retreated to her
room, closed the door, and stood there, just looking out her
window into the mysterious outdoors. "OH NO!" Kagome yelled.
"I dropped the shards in the other era! Now I definitely can go
back to see Inuyasha, Oh, I hope he comes back for me, or
else, we can never meat again. What am I saying, he is
probally out kissing Kikiyo again." Kagome reminded herself.
Looking into the clouds, without even thinking, to Kagome,
everyone reminded her of Inuyasha. His silver hair flying in the
wind's breezes, his golden eyes capturing her heart. How could
she forget him?
------------
To Inuyahsa
"Should I go down the well to find her? What happiness if she
didn't want me to come for her? What if she found a new guy
by now? Should I just forget about her?" Inuyahsa silently
thought. Lying in the grass beside the well, Inuyahsa looked up
into the wondrous sky. Everything about it made the
surroundings more enchanting. The wind brushed against his
face, the birds sang around him, reminding him of Kagome,
and how beautiful her voice sounded to him, and he sweet
lilac scent swimming the breeze reminded Inuyahsa about
what she smelled like after coming out of the hot spings after
her 'bath'. After remembering all this, Inuyasha realized, he has
to go back for Kagome, because he loves her. "But how am I
supposed to tell Kagome this was all a mistake? Oh well I have
to go back for her before she figures that I hate her." Inuyahsa
quickly though. Without hesitation, Inuyahsa quickly jumped
into the well on his way to Japan.
